6.6.25 Steep Approach Discrete #2

Activates steep approach biasing if Steep Approach Enabled is true (see Category 7, Section 5.3.7).

Alt. Action Type: Supplied by an alternate action (latching) and self indicating cockpit switch .

Momentary Type: Supplied by a momentary (non-latching) switch with switch lamp driven by EGPWS Steep Approach

Discrete output.

Signal Status:

Steep Approach Selected or not Selected

Fault monitoring: None if Steep Approach Enabled is false. EGPWS Self-Test is inhibited if Steep Approach Enabled is

true and Steep Approach Discrete #2 is “Selected” on the ground. For momentary switch inputs,
activation of this switch input for more than 15 seconds will result in the “Steep Approach Invalid”
fault which will cause a GPWS INOP indication.

Level 6 Audio readout

Steep Approach Discrete #2

Selected =>

Not Selected =>

“Steep Approach Selected”
“Steep Approach Not Selected”

6.6.26 Timed Audio Inhibit Discrete

Type:

Supplied by a momentary action (internally latching) and indicating cockpit switch for inhibit of audio functions.

Signal Status:

Audio Inhibit or not Inhibit

Fault monitoring: The Audio Inhibit function does not inhibit Self Test, therefore, “Timed Audio Inhibited Fault” will be

enunciated during cockpit Level 2 Self Test.

Level 6 Audio readout

Timed Audio Inhibit Discrete

Selected =>

Not Selected =>

“Timed Audio Inhibit”
“Timed Audio Not Inhibit”

6.6.27 GPWS Inhibit Discrete

This discrete inhibits all audio and visual except for Windshear, Terrain Awareness and TCF.

Type:

Supplied by an alternate action (latching) and self indicating cockpit switch.

Signal Status:

GPWS enabled or disabled

Fault monitoring: Activation of this input for more than 5 seconds will result in the ‘GPWS Inhibit’ fault which will

cause a GPWS INOP indication.

Level 6 Audio readout

GPWS Inhibit Discrete

Selected =>

Not Selected =>

“GPWS Inhibit”
“GPWS Not Inhibit”

6.6.28 Localizer Validity Discrete #1

A Localizer Validity discrete may be used by the EGPWS for localizer input from an ARINC 547 Nav Receiver.

Type:

Validity from ARINC 547 Nav Receiver

Signal Status:

Valid or Invalid

Level 6 Audio readout

Localizer Validity Discrete #1

Valid =>

Invalid =>

“Localizer 1 Valid”
“Localizer 1 Invalid”
